L-Arginine

L-arginine is probably the most heart healthy amino acid in existence. The substance plays a leading role in raising nitric oxide levels in the body. As arginine supplements elevate nitric oxide levels, it enables the penis to achieve an erection.
Clinical studies prove the effectiveness of l-arginine. Scientific researchers administered a study using l-arginine. Fifty men, afflicted with erectile dysfunction, were given l-arginine or a placebo for more than a month. The findings showed that the study group using arginine experienced a noticeable improvement in sexual performance.
In a different study group, men with low testosterone levels were given l-arginine. More than two-thirds of the participants had substantial improvements. Other researchers contend that arginine not only helps trigger a reliable erection, but also boosts the libido.

Case Studies in Arginine and Yohimbe
To test the effects of a nitric oxide enhancer with yohimbe for erectile dysfunction, researchers used arginine, a natural amino acid. Forty-five men participated in the clinical trial. During the double blind, placebo-controlled assessment, some men were given the combination of yohimbe (6 mg) and arginine (6g) — or yohimbe with a placebo (alone). They were instructed to use the natural male enhancements two-hours prior to intimacy.

The findings proved without a doubt that yohimbe and arginine drastically promote better erections in men who suffer from erectile dysfunction.

The same research findings were reported in the publication of European Urology (2002; 41:608-13). According to this clinical study, dual action of yohimbe and arginine for the treatment of erectile dysfunction is mutually as effective as Viagra®.

In conclusion, both medical trials demonstrated that yohimbe and arginine require single dose administration before intercourse and these natural male enhancement supplements are just as powerful as prescribed medications.

Zinc
Zinc is vital to the development and function of the male sex organs. Males with zinc deficiency have been shown to have less developed testes and reduced sperm count. Zinc supplements may be used as a potential treatment for ED. Zinc helps produce key sex hormones, such as testosterone and prolactin

Solidilin
Solidilin in conjunction with zinc is promoted as a male enhancement herb. Other marketing materials tout Solidilin as a cardiovascular booster. In terms of improving testosterone production, a study at the School of Pharmaceutical Sciences at the University of Science Malaysia tested the supplement on middle-aged rats only. There is not any conclusive evidence that solidilin improves sexual performance in humans.
